West Bengal's Chief Minister reveals previously concealed investigation documents related to a controversial 1993 police encounter, accusing the opposition Trinamool Congress party of instrumentalizing the incident for electoral advantage. The disclosure in the state assembly exposes allegations that political parties manipulated historical events to consolidate voter support, raising questions about institutional transparency and accountability in regional governance.
